Daycare Cost in Mineral County, MT

Childcare pricing data for Mineral County, Montana (2022). Population: 4,652.

$11,428
Center infant (annual)
$8,978
Family infant (annual)
20%
of median household income

Compared to Montana Average

Center-based infant care in Mineral County costs $11,428/year, which is $39 less (0% below average) compared to the Montana average of $11,467/year.

All Childcare Prices

Care Type Weekly Annual (52 weeks)
Center-Based Infant $220/week $11,428
Center-Based Toddler $228/week $11,832
Center-Based Preschool $196/week $10,203
Family Infant $173/week $8,978
Family Toddler $176/week $9,140
Family Preschool $176/week $9,140

Affordability Context

The median household income in Mineral County is $56,098. The U.S. Department of Health and Human Services considers childcare affordable when it costs no more than 7% of household income. At 20%, center-based infant care in Mineral County exceeds this threshold.
